Choose between a fine, medium, or coarse surface. Set up the ladder/scaffolding/lift and begin scraping with a 6”–12” scraper—with lengthy stokes quite than a back-and-forth movement. Repeat in 4’ increments until the ceiling is totally scraped. Consider utilizing a container or pan, like a mud pan, to catch all of the scrapings as you scrape—it will reduce the amount of cleanup.


Use your popcorn ceiling patch product to patch within the damaged areas. Choosing the best patch product is essential. You will get one of the best outcomes from a mix-it-yourself product.

They are a mode of dimpled drywall ceiling well-liked from 1945 to the early Nineties. Popcorn ceilings applied earlier than the Nineties are more than likely to contain asbestos. The fire-resistant mineral was popular in constructing materials till the Nineteen Eighties. Exposure to asbestos in popcorn ceilings may cause mesothelioma most cancers. The written contract ought to list details of the work and cleanup, and any federal, state and local regulations that must be followed, including notification and disposal procedures. To find out what these are, contact your state and native health departments and the EPA regional workplace . When done, the contractor should present a written statement saying all required procedures were adopted. One of the most effective things about a ceiling cover-up job is you could cut holes within the ceiling without fussy repairs later. So it’s the proper time to add or transfer light fixtures, install a ceiling fan or run networking cables. If there’s residing space above the ceiling, you can even fix floor squeaks or run new plumbing for a future bathroom rework.

Cost guides provided by Golden-based HomeAdvisor estimate that popcorn ceiling removing projects in Denver cost a median of $1,500. Professional asbestos abatement more than doubles that price, to an estimated $3,300.

Can I shiplap over popcorn ceiling?

Yes. You can use shiplap to hide the popcorn ceiling. If your popcorn ceiling has imperfections and you do not want to undergo the bills or mess of removing it, covering them with Shiplap planks will upgrade your room.

Popcorn ceilings weren't initially put in place because of a style pattern or due to hillbilles, however rather for their operate in reducing echo in rooms. That leads to sound reflection, whereas the popcorn ceilings take up the sound and create a quiet room. Now in modern occasions, people are less targeted on lowering echo, we’ve gotten used to it. Spray-texture ceiling finishes, commonly known as popcorn or cottage cheese ceilings, are sometimes the goal of a owners' scorn. The texture is claimed to have acoustical benefits, but mostly these old finishes have been favored by builders as a end result of they decreased the amount of ending work the drywaller needed to do.
